What VOCs actually are
Volatile organic compounds are chemicals that evaporate from paint into indoor air during application and curing. Health effects include:
- Short-term: headaches, dizziness, respiratory irritation
- Long-term: potential contribution to chronic respiratory conditions, certain cancers
The U.S. EPA indoor air quality program publishes exposure guidance that has shaped regulatory VOC limits over recent decades.
VOC categories in paint
- High VOC (250+ g/L): Legacy alkyd/oil-based paints, some specialty coatings. Increasingly restricted.
- Low VOC (50-100 g/L): Standard modern latex paints.
- Very low VOC (under 50 g/L): Premium latex paints.
- Zero VOC (under 5 g/L): Certified low-emission paints.
Certifications to recognize
- Green Seal certification: Rigorous third-party VOC and safety certification.
- GreenGuard Gold: Indoor air quality certification (chemicals-of-concern beyond just VOCs).
- MPI (Master Painters Institute) Green: Industry-specific green product listing.
- USDA BioPreferred: Recognizes biobased content.
Beyond VOCs — other chemistry matters
VOC content is one measure; ingredient safety is another. Consider:
- Absence of chemicals of concern (phthalates, formaldehyde, heavy metals)
- Biobased binder content (biodegradable, lower embodied energy)
- Recyclable or reusable packaging
Application quality with low-VOC paints
Modern low-VOC paints often perform better than their high-VOC predecessors:
- Better coverage (hiding power)
- Easier cleanup (water-based)
- Less odor during application
- Faster occupancy after painting
- Comparable durability in most applications
ASTM International publishes performance testing standards that apply equally to low-VOC and traditional paints — quality can be verified independently of VOC content.
When higher-VOC options still make sense
A few applications still justify higher-VOC formulations:
- Extreme durability requirements (some industrial coatings)
- Very specific solvent-based chemistry (some primers on difficult substrates)
- Emergency conditions where low-VOC won't dry adequately
Even in these cases, minimum-VOC alternatives are often available.

Regulatory landscape
VOC limits vary by state and locality. California's regulations (CARB) are typically the strictest and often anticipate federal EPA changes. The U.S. EPA energy program publishes federal minimum guidance that all states must meet, though many exceed it.
Cost considerations
Low-VOC paint pricing:
- Standard low-VOC latex: no premium over conventional latex
- Zero-VOC certified: 5-15% premium
- Biobased binder options: 15-30% premium
The cost premium for entry-level low-VOC options is typically zero — meaning eco-friendly is not more expensive for most residential painting.

Disposal of leftover paint
Never dispose of leftover paint in regular trash. Options:
- Municipal household hazardous waste programs
- Paint recycling programs (PaintCare in many states)
- Donation to community organizations
- Storage for future touch-ups (small quantities)
